科学领域:

  • 机械工程 机械工程
  • 材料科学 材料科学 材料科学
  • 应用物理 应用物理

背景情况:

  • 弹性固定是各种应用中振动和冲击吸收的关键组件.
  • 准确预测它们的静态和动态特性对于有效的设计和机械性能至关重要.
  • 了解这些特征对于优化振动隔离系统在海上应用等苛刻环境中的优化尤为重要.

研究的目的:

  • 调查和预测弹性山的静态和动态特征.
  • 校准和验证超弹性材料模型来描述安装行为.
  • 分析预负载对弹性件动态反应的影响.

主要方法:

  • 进行了近静态张力,压缩和剪切测试,以生成应力-张力曲线.
  • 审查了Yeoh超弹性模型,并使用实验数据对其参数进行校准.
  • 进行了数值分析和模拟,包括模式分析和频率响应.
  • 通过将数值预测与实验准静态测试结果进行比较来实现验证.

主要成果:

  • 对于弹性安装材料,Yeoh模型参数已成功校准和验证.
  • 发现增加预负载会显著地将传导曲线和共振峰值转移到更低的频率.
  • 动态行为分析提供了关于预加载如何影响振动隔离性能的见解.

结论:

  • 这项研究提供了关于弹性架的静态和动态特征的宝贵见解.
  • 这些发现有助于改进振动隔离系统的设计和优化.
  • 这项研究对于提高在海上应用中弹性件的性能特别重要.
